How do I Recycle Mobile Devices and Laptops in Vancouver Safely?
Recycling your mobile devices and laptops safely in Vancouver involves both securing your personal information and choosing an environmentally responsible disposal method. Since British Columbia regulations make it illegal to dispose of electronics in regular trash, we provide a professional pickup service to ensure your tech is handled legally and safely.
To prepare your devices for recycling, we recommend these essential steps:
- Data Security: Back up your important files, then perform a factory reset or use data-destruction software to wipe personal information from phones, tablets, and laptops.
- Battery Removal: Remove all batteries, including lithium-ion cells, and set them aside for separate handling.
- Physical Preparation: Wipe away dust and residue, and remove or black out any stickers containing personal information, such as addresses or account numbers.
